Description

This specimen of Gander's cholla displays two striking lime-green flowers with prominent yellow stamens, indicative of its vibrant blooming phase. Its segmented, spiny stems are characteristic of the species, presenting a unique challenge for bonsai styling due to its succulent nature and lack of traditional woody trunk.
